Grants paid by Leo V Berger Fund, tax year 2025

EIN 51-0196887 · Miami, FL · Form 990-PF, Part XV

In tax year 2025, Leo V Berger Fund (EIN 51-0196887) reported 6 grants paid totaling $190,000.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
